NOTICE TO BIDDERS
PUBLIC N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that sealed bids will be received by the Township of Maple
Shade for the Pickleball Courts at Woodlawn Sports Complex in the Township of Maple Shade,
Burlington County, New Jersey.
Bid forms, contracts and specifications are available by contacting Remington & Vernick Engineers.
Contact shall be made by phone or by email to make bid purchase arrangements. At 856 795 9595 or by
submitting RVEbidinterest@rve.com.
Said Bids will be received, opened and read aloud in public at the Municipal Building, Township of
Maple Shade, 200 Stiles Avenue, Maple Shade, Burlington County, New Jersey on Thursday, June 4,
2026, at 10:15 AM prevailing time.
Electronic download link for copies of the bid forms, contracts and specifications may be obtained from
said Remington and Vernick Engineers, by prospective bidders upon request, upon payment of the sum of
$50.00 for each set. Should interested bidders not have the ability to handle electronic download sets, a
set may be arranged to be sent overnight by calling 856 795 9595.
NO BIDS ARE TO BE PICKED UP AT THE ENGINEER’S OFFICE OR AT THE
MUNICIPALITY OFFICES.
PAYMENT MUST BE RECEIVED PRIOR TO OBTAINING SAID SPECIFICATIONS.
NO BIDS ARE TO BE DROPPED OFF AT THE ENGINEER’S OFFICE.
The Township of Maple Shade reserves the right to consider the bids for sixty (60) days after the receipt
thereof, and further reserves the right to reject any or all bids, either in whole or in part and also to waive
any informality in any and make such awards or take action as may be in the best interest of the Township
of Maple Shade, in accordance with applicable law.
Bids must be on the bid form prepared by Remington and Vernick Engineers, in the manner designated
therein and required by the specifications, must be enclosed in sealed envelopes bearing the name and
address of the bidder on the outside and also bearing on the outside reference to the particular work bid
upon. Said bids shall be addressed to Andrea T. McVeigh, Clerk, Township of Maple Shade, 200 Stiles
Avenue, Maple Shade, New Jersey 08052.
Each bid shall be accompanied by a certified check, cashier’s check or bid bond duly executed by the
bidder as principal and having as surety thereon a surety company approved by the Township of Maple
Shade in an amount not less than ten percent (10%) but in no case in excess of $20,000.00 of the amount
bid. Any such bid bond shall be without endorsement or conditions. Bid shall also be accompanied by a
certificate letter from a surety company stating that it will provide the bidder with the completion bond.
The award of the contract shall be made subject to the necessary moneys to do the work being provided
by the Township of Maple Shade in a lawful manner. The contract to be executed by the successful
bidder will provide that it shall not become effective until the necessary moneys to do the work have been
provided by the Township of Maple Shade in a lawful manner. The award shall further be subjected to
the securing of necessary State, Federal or Local permits governing the work.
Bidders are required to comply with the requirements of N.J.S.A. 10:5-31 et seq., N.J.A.C. 17:27
(Affirmative Action), N.J.S.A. 34:11-56.25 et seq.(New Jersey Prevailing Wage Act), and Americans
with Disabilities Act of 1990 (42 U.S.C. S12101, et seq.).
The contractor is further notified that he must comply with N.J.S.A. 52:25-24.2, and submit a Disclosure
Statement listing stockholders with his bid.
The contractor is further notified that he must comply with N.J.S.A. 34:11-56.48 et seq. Public Works
Contractor Registration Act and he and any subcontractors must be registered in accordance with the act.
The contractor is also further notified that he must comply with N.J.S.A. 52:32-44 and submit proof of
business registration and submit proof of business registration for any named subcontractors in
accordance with the act.
